Oil Splash Guard Reduces Component Wear

Extending the Life of Components Exposure to oil splatter can be corrosive over time, eating away at paint, rubber seals, and plastic components. When oil is splashed onto components like spark plugs or intake manifolds, it can cause misfires, reduced combustion efficiency, and a drop in power output.

Oil Splash Guard Reduces Component Wear

This versatility makes them an indispensable tool for any industry that utilizes lubricants to ensure smooth operation. An oil splash guard is a fundamental component in many mechanical and industrial environments, designed to contain lubricants and prevent unwanted spillage.

The design is often tailored to specific applications, featuring contours that match the engine bay or machinery layout. A well-placed guard ensures that the oil remains in the sump or reservoir, maintaining consistent lubrication and thermal management for optimal performance.

Oil Splash Guard Reduces Component Wear

Without this defense, lubricant can quickly contaminate surrounding surfaces, air filters, and sensitive electrical systems. Industrial gearboxes, agricultural machinery, marine propulsion systems, and heavy construction equipment all rely on similar containment strategies.
